The transcript discusses the potential impacts of proposed economic policies, including tax cuts and deregulation, on the US economy. It highlights skepticism about the effectiveness of these measures, drawing comparisons with past administrations. The discussion also covers the challenges posed by tariffs on manufacturing and the broader trend of declining manufacturing in advanced economies.
